输入一个正整数,以逆序输出其各位数字.(c语言程序怎么写)

来源:百度知道 编辑:UC知道 时间:2024/09/14 06:10:41
输入一个正整数,以逆序输出其各位数字.例如:123,逆序为321.(c语言程序怎么写,并麻烦为我解释下程序,谢谢!)

#include <stdio.h>

int main(void)
{
int n;
scanf("%d",&n);
getchar();
int num = 0;
while(n !=0)
{
num *= 10;
num += (n%10);
n = n/10;
}
printf("%d",num);
getchar();
return 0;
}

#include<stdio.h>
void main()
{
int i;
scanf("%d",&i);
while(i)
{
printf("%d",i%10);
i=i/10;
}
}

int n = 123;
char str[256];
sprintf(str, "%d", n);
int len = strlen(str);
for(int i = len - 1; i >= 0; i--)
printf("%c", str[i]);
printf("\n");

输入一个四位正整数,编写程序将其逆序输出 输入一个等腰三角形,整型数逆序输出 编写一个程序输入一个整数,将其逆序输出,输出格式为整数(用C语言) 写C语言要求从键盘上输入一个3位的数值,并将其逆序输出 c语言: 输入一个十进制正整数,将其转换成八进制数,并输出结果。 c语言输入一个不多于5位正整数要求:求出它是几位数;分别打印出每一位数字;按逆序输出各位数字。 VB编程:用inputBOX输入一个字符串,以逆序形式输出。分别采用步长为正和负编程。 VB 随机产生一个三位正整数,然后逆序输出,产生的数与逆序数同时显示 输入一个小于30000的正整数,要求以相反的顺序输出该数。 一个十进制正整数,以二进制数输出.